Chronic stress: Acute or short term stress is not as damaging as chronic, ongoing stress day in day out for years. So there is ample time to regulate your life, retrain your mind and de-stress yourself. Exercise and meditation can help reduce stress provided you practice this daily.

Depends: Depends on type of stress. The stress of excess radiation ( mostly sun) ages skin. So does smoking. If anxiety makes you pull your hair or smoke, then stress may age skin or hair. If stress drives you into the tanning salon, then it ages your skin. Not the answer you expected? But that's the way it is.
